Sage Neighborhood Overview
Overview
Sage is a quiet, established residential neighborhood in southwest Ogden, nestled against the foothills of the Wasatch Range. It is known for its spacious lots, mature trees, and stunning mountain views, offering a suburban feel with convenient city access. The area is primarily composed of single-family homes and is part of the Ogden City School District.

Housing
Housing in Sage consists largely of mid-century and late 20th-century ranch-style homes and split-levels on generously sized lots. Architectural styles are varied but generally modest, with many homes featuring updates and expansions. The area is prized for its affordability compared to newer foothill developments, offering more space for the price.
Getting Around
Sage is conveniently accessed via major arteries like 36th Street and Harrison Boulevard, providing quick routes to I-15 and downtown Ogden. The neighborhood's internal streets are wide, low-traffic, and arranged in a grid-like pattern, making navigation easy. Public transit service is limited, so commuting primarily relies on personal vehicles.

Parks & Recreation
Sage is adjacent to the expansive Ogden Botanical Gardens and is a short drive from the trailheads of the Bonneville Shoreline Trail for hiking and mountain biking. The neighborhood itself features several small pocket parks and green spaces. Its location provides easy access to the Weber River Parkway and the recreational opportunities of the entire Wasatch Front.
